An investigation of methane partial oxidation kinetics over Rh-supported catalysts

The kinetics of CH4 partial oxidation was investigated in a structured reactor at high space velocity under well-controlled operating conditions. High temperatures favored the production of CO and H-2. At increasing space velocity, CO and H-2 selectivities showed a moderate and a strong decrease respectively. Increase Of O-2/CH4 feed ratio caused a shift to higher temperatures of methane conversion and syngas production. These effects could be accounted for by a simplified kinetic scheme, which includes methane deep oxidation, steam and dry reforming, WGS and the consecutive oxidations of CO and H-2.
